The Ultimate Guide To Software Companies In Indianapolis

Wiki Article

Getting My Software Companies In Indianapolis To Work

Table of ContentsThe 25-Second Trick For Software Companies In IndianapolisOur Software Companies In Indianapolis PDFsRumored Buzz on Software Companies In IndianapolisThe Ultimate Guide To Software Companies In IndianapolisSoftware Companies In Indianapolis - Questions
With so many people and departments involved, it is necessary to have one person identifying the job's direction. There ought to be one senior project manager who makes the last decision on all major questions regarding the workflow. Software Companies in Indianapolis. It should be a person with sufficient skills and also experience in preparation and also job execution

The sources will be various for each software growth task plan. It depends on the idea as well as the size of the project.



This analysis assists programmers comprehend the requirements and also goals of the software advancement procedure. The length of the checklist will depend on the software application project. There are numerous aspects to consider. They consist of the scope of the job and just how in-depth the initial demands and objectives are. Large tasks commonly involve numerous stakeholders or broad goals.

Appointments with individuals in the work environment can offer an entirely various view of the trouble. The dimension of the organization will identify which and also the number of individuals to involve in the process. This area is certainly extremely vital. Every action related to a software application growth project is connected with prices.

6 Easy Facts About Software Companies In Indianapolis Described

Software Companies in IndianapolisSoftware Companies in Indianapolis
This will assist to make a price quote of the complete price of the task. There should be a balance in between spending plan and also top quality. Because of this, lots of firms currently like to contract out growth: they located it extra cost-efficient than doing it inside. The software program advancement plan must include an approximate meaning of all the job stages, a timeline of the needed actions and also their due dates.

Prior to starting a job, it is not constantly 100% clear just how to complete it completely. So make the effort to make a list of what needs to be done and also make use of as much detail as possible to make the big picture clearer. Having a listing of jobs as well as an introduction of the spending plan and human resources, you can estimate the time required.

It takes into consideration job schedules and validates the sources that the task will utilize. The trouble with software growth jobs is that they involve threat and also uncertainty. Hence, the reasonable point to do is to determine some barrier time for every job. On top of that, the project supervisor must ensure that the task follows the developed strategy - Software Companies in Indianapolis.

During sprint conferences, supervisors, developers as well as other job participants get together to discuss what tasks are arranged for this week. Any type of technique works, however it has to fulfill the requirements and assumptions of the task.

Examine This Report about Software Companies In Indianapolis

The skills and also experience of a group member identify the nature of the job. The job leader or manager must establish which task to assign to which programmer. Checking, tracking, as well as bug repairing are carried out in parallel with the software development process. This is a continual task targeted at removing as numerous issues as possible and relocating the job ahead.

Software Companies in IndianapolisSoftware Companies in Indianapolis
Even after the software is released, it is valuable for designers to have a normal look back at their work - Software Companies in Indianapolis. Software growth is a really vibrant and also rapidly progressing field.


Issues adhere to one after an additional, and developers are the ones who obtain all the blame. Under Learn More no scenarios need to processes be left to chance.

If the company doesn't figure out the approximate target dates for the shipment of the job, its group needs to really ponder the fact that such mayhem will not lead to any type of excellent. The application of the concept is necessary to combat Parkinson's law, which specifies that the overall amount of job will constantly increase in order to load constantly allocated for work.

The 7-Minute Rule for Software Companies In Indianapolis

You require to schedule some time so that the team does not have to hurry its work and make blunders as an outcome. Do not neglect the time required to debug the software program in order to bring it to the needed level of secure operation with an appropriate number of bugs.

Software Companies in IndianapolisSoftware Companies in Indianapolis
Overestimations lead to a boost in the number of errors in the code. It will take substantially even more time to debug and also repair them in the future, so it's far better to intend very carefully as well as save the moment required for that right now. The selection of a specific program is a matter of taste.

It acts as an overview to keeping the task according to the budget plan, resources, as well as due dates. This, subsequently, assists to achieve the collection goals and keep clear as well as effective interaction. Yes, creating a software application development task plan requires time, however the investment deserves it. On the various other hand, if you are selecting outsourced development in cooperation with a reliable companion, after that you will be saved of all the planning-related headaches.

Call us to get a free appointment and make sure that your task will be in the right-hand men.

The Software Companies In Indianapolis PDFs

The Software Application Development hop over to these guys Refine is the structured strategy to developing software application for a system or job, often called the Software application over here Development Life Process (SDLC). There are a number of approaches (see Software program Growth Approaches) that can be utilized to consist of falls, spiral, and incremental development. These different methods will certainly focus the screening initiative at various factors in the development process.

Report this wiki page